Originally Posted by Ellie May Drooling is most common with neurological problems, pain, nausea, and tooth problems.
Since it's happening in his sleep, I'd look at tooth problems first.
It couldn't hurt to get another bile acids test, esp. if the first one was done before 20 weeks. There are other neurological issues that could cause it too. It doesn't seem like these things would be worse while he is sleeping though. Has he lost all of his baby teeth? If he is older, are any of his teeth loose/gums inflamed? |
